When it comes to deadlines, I like to finish my work in advance so I give myself deadlines prior to my actual deadlines. I work best last minute so my self proclaimed deadlines are usually a week before my actual deadlines. This gives me just enough desperation to churn out a piece of work as best as I can, yet, leaves me with more than enough time to tweak it into the best product I can produce.
I did use the time management calculator, and by some stroke of good fortune, I happened to spend 2 hours on schoolwork for every 1 hour I spend in school. Prior to this, I never knew that was the ideal amount of time allocated for schoolwork. Knowing this left me pleasantly surprised so, as much as possible, it is something I will strive to keep to.
